
Define one-watt hour and one-kilowatt hour.

Complete step by step solution
The kilowatt-hour is expressed as the unit of energy. It is equal to Kilojoules. For example, it is used to calculate the unit of billing for electricity. A kilowatt-hour is a combination unit of energy and it is equal to the one Kilo-watt. Hour is the unit of time it is listed among the non-SI units. Energy is the delivery of the work. Power is the delivery of energy. It is measured in Kilowatts.
It is measured by the running time of the electrical device by multiplying the power consumption of the devices in kilowatts by the time of operation for the device it is measured in hours so we call it one kilowatt-hour. Generally, a one-kilowatt hour is for one hour it is consumed by the one unit of a charge. So one kilowatt-hour is the energy consumed when the one kilowatt of power is used for one hour.
Watt-hour is measured by using the amount of work performed or generated by electrical appliances. But other electrical devices perform the work and it requires energy in the form of electricity. So, a one-watt hour is energy consumed by the one watt of power it is used for one hour.
Note: One kilowatt is equal to the thousand watts of power, it is used for one hour. The kilowatt-hour is measured by the running time of the electrical device. Both the watts are measured by the running time of the devices but consumption of the power will change.
